Deferred Motions from the October Area Committee Meeting

447      Councillor Michael Mullooly’s Deferred Motion

This Area Committee calls on the Area Manager or a delegated member of his staff to visit and report to this Committee on the potential for improvement, maintenance, condition of Poddle Park (the green area across from the KCR along the Poddle River). This little park has significant potential but it is poorly maintained and because of this attracts illegal dumping and anti-social activity.

November Motions

459      Councillor Tina Mac Veigh

This Area Committee agrees that, in preparation for the Ceannt Fort Estate Centenary Celebrations in 2017, a schedule of works will be carried out as follows: Entrance wall pointing, signage, lamp post, railing and footpath painting and renovation, marking out car parking spaces in upper and lower car parks; public drainage; regular maintenance of public spaces (inc new playground area); street signage. The Area Office will meet representatives of the Ceannt Fort Residents Association to discuss the above renovations and in addition to provide them with guidance on entrance signage that incorporates direction within the estate and short bilingual history. 

 

460      Councillor Críona Ní Dhálaigh

That this Area Committee views with concern the manner in which Nicolas and Myra Carmen's Hall Community Centre was converted into a homeless hostel.

 

461      Councillor Paul Hand

That this Area Committee supports the full and complete restoration of the Christmas Night Luas on the Red line and requests that Luas management take steps to ensure the same service is provided on the Red Line and the Green Line this Christmas. To this end we request that this motion be forwarded to Luas management for consideration.
